Eloralintide (LY3841136) is an investigational, long-acting synthetic analog of human amylin designed to preferentially activate the amylin 1 receptor (AMY1R). It is studied in metabolic research involving satiation signaling, food-intake regulation, gastric-motility pathways, post-meal glucagon signaling, and body-composition endpoints. Eloralintide works through the amylin pathway rather than the GLP-1 pathway. Endogenous amylin is a 37-amino-acid hormone co-secreted with insulin after nutrient intake. Amylin receptors are complexes formed by the calcitonin receptor (CTR) and one of three receptor-activity-modifying proteins (RAMP1, RAMP2, or RAMP3), producing AMY1R, AMY2R, and AMY3R.
Preferential AMY1R activation: AMY1R is the CTR-RAMP1 receptor complex. In the published discovery study, eloralintide acted as a full agonist in cyclic-AMP assays and was reported to be approximately 12-fold more potent at human AMY1R than at human CTR and approximately 11-fold more potent at human AMY1R than at human AMY3R. “Preferential” does not mean exclusive: receptor response can vary with receptor composition, expression level, assay design, and concentration.
Pathways studied: amylin-receptor signaling is associated with satiation and meal termination, gastric-motility regulation, post-meal glucagon signaling, and energy-balance endpoints. In preclinical rat studies reported during discovery, eloralintide reduced food intake and body weight in a dose-dependent manner, with the weight change predominantly attributed to fat mass. These are model-specific findings and are not treatment claims.
Development status: published phase 1 and 48-week randomized phase 2 studies have evaluated once-weekly investigational eloralintide in adults with overweight or obesity. The compound remains in clinical development and is not an approved medicine. Clinical-trial results refer to the sponsor's investigational drug product and do not validate this research material for human use.
Key published records: discovery and receptor pharmacology, DOI 10.1016/j.molmet.2025.102271; phase 1 study, DOI 10.1111/dom.70439; phase 2 study, DOI 10.1016/S0140-6736(25)02155-5 and ClinicalTrials.gov NCT06230523.
This product is supplied as a lyophilized powder. Unopened vials can be stored at room temperature for up to 2 years when kept sealed, dry, and protected from light. Avoid excessive heat, moisture, and repeated temperature changes during storage.
After reconstitution, store the solution at 2-8°C, protected from light, and use it within 30 days. Label the vial with the reconstitution date. Use sterile handling, avoid vigorous shaking and repeated freeze-thaw cycles, and do not use the material if the seal is damaged or if persistent particles, unexpected cloudiness, or discoloration is present after dissolution.
